| lightning Member Since: 23 Apr 2009 Location: High Peak, Derbyshire Posts: 3542    | Solved it!
 Reset the pivi pro (held down the power button for 20 seconds) and it's all come back, Google maps re appeared and the SIM is back online | ||

| XplusYplusZ Member Since: 16 Aug 2021 Location: UK Posts: 553  | Might be obvious, might not.. the quickest way I've found to switch nav source is:
 1. Home Screen 2. Little nav source icon (red square) 3. Choose pivi or carplay   Click image to enlarge | ||
